About Financial Services Regulation Law in Nilphamari, Bangladesh

Financial services regulation in Nilphamari, Bangladesh, is a crucial aspect of the legal framework that governs the activities of financial institutions, ensuring their operations align with national and international standards. The regulation encompasses various sectors, including banking, insurance, securities, and microfinance. In Nilphamari, like elsewhere in Bangladesh, these regulations are influenced by the country's economic policies and the need to safeguard consumer interests, ensure transparency, and maintain the integrity of the financial system. The Bangladesh Bank, along with other regulatory bodies, plays a vital role in enforcing these laws, ensuring that financial institutions operate within set guidelines to foster economic stability and growth.

Local Laws Overview

In Nilphamari, key aspects of financial services regulations include adherence to the Bank Company Act, regulations from the Security and Exchange Commission, and guidelines from the Insurance Development and Regulatory Authority. These laws aim to promote fair competition, safeguard investors' interests, and ensure transparency in financial dealings. Additionally, anti-money laundering and counter-terrorism financing measures are stringent, requiring institutions to implement robust compliance programs. Entrepreneurs and consumers alike should be aware of specific local adaptations of these regulations that apply within Nilphamari's jurisdiction.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main financial services regulations in Bangladesh?

The main regulations include the Bank Company Act 1991, Financial Institution Act 1993, Securities and Exchange Commission Act 1993, and the Insurance Act 2010.

How do financial regulations affect consumers?

These regulations protect consumers by ensuring transparent disclosure of financial products, fair treatment, and the safety of deposits and investments.

What is the role of Bangladesh Bank in financial regulation?

Bangladesh Bank is the central regulatory authority overseeing monetary policy, bank licensing, and enforcing compliance with banking regulations.

Can small businesses benefit from financial regulation laws?

Yes, regulations ensure small businesses have access to fair credit terms, transparent financial services, and protection from fraud.

How are insurance companies regulated in Nilphamari?

Insurance companies are overseen by the Insurance Development and Regulatory Authority, which ensures compliance with the Insurance Act 2010.

What penalties can financial institutions face for non-compliance?

Penalties can include fines, revocation of licenses, and legal action against the institution's directors.
